7 Foods That Reduce Gas and Bloating Naturally

Stomach gas and bloating are problems most people deal with at some point in their lives. These issues can appear suddenly and make you feel heavy, uncomfortable, or unable to focus on your work. In a fast-growing city like Dubai, where people often eat in a hurry, skip meals, or choose oily food, digestive discomfort has become even more common.

The good thing is that simple changes in your diet can make a big difference. Nature provides several foods that calm the stomach and help reduce gas naturally. These foods are not only easy to find but also very safe for daily use. Below, we explain 7 foods that reduce gas and bloating naturally, along with how they work to improve your digestion.

Understanding Gas and Bloating

Before looking at the foods, it's important to understand why gas forms in the first place.

Why Does the Stomach Feel Heavy?

Gas forms when your body cannot digest food properly. Sometimes the food moves slowly through the intestines, leading to pressure and swelling. This causes the stomach to feel tight and uncomfortable.

Common Reasons Behind Digestive Problems

  • Eating too quickly

  • Drinking fizzy drinks

  • Eating fried or oily meals

  • Swallowing air while drinking through straws

  • Stress or anxiety

  • Food that does not suit your body

Knowing the cause can help you make better choices, but adding the right foods can help bring relief faster.

1. Ginger

Ginger has been used for thousands of years to calm stomach issues.

Why Ginger Helps

It contains natural compounds that relax the digestive muscles. This helps trapped gas move out of the body more easily. Ginger also helps the stomach break down food faster, preventing bloating.

How to Use Ginger

  • Drink warm ginger tea

  • Add slices of ginger to hot water

  • Mix grated ginger into soups or dishes

Even a small amount of ginger can help your stomach feel more comfortable.

2. Yogurt (With Probiotics)

Yogurt is one of the best foods for healthy digestion.

Supports Good Gut Bacteria

Probiotic yogurt helps increase the “good bacteria” in your stomach. These friendly bacteria help digestion run smoothly and prevent gas formation.

Reduces Bloating Naturally

Probiotics stop the fermentation process in the stomach, which is what usually creates gas. Cold yogurt also feels refreshing in warm places like Dubai.

Choose yogurts such as:

  • Plain yogurt

  • Greek yogurt

  • Yogurt with added probiotics

Avoid flavored yogurts with too much sugar.

3. Peppermint

Peppermint is known for its cooling and calming effect on the stomach.

Relaxes the Digestive System

Peppermint helps the muscles in your stomach relax, allowing trapped gas to pass easily.

Reduces Stomach Cramps

It contains menthol, which soothes the stomach lining and reduces cramping.

Ways to enjoy peppermint:

  • Peppermint tea

  • Fresh mint leaves in warm water

  • Mint chutney

4. Fennel Seeds

Fennel seeds are a traditional remedy widely used across the Middle East and South Asia.

Helps Push Out Gas Naturally

Fennel seeds help relax the digestive muscles and push gas out of the stomach. They are one of the quickest natural solutions for bloating.

How to Take Fennel Seeds

  • Chew half a teaspoon after meals

  • Drink fennel tea

  • Add fennel seeds to cooking

They are simple, safe, and effective for people of all ages.

5. Papaya

Papaya is one of the best fruits for improving digestion.

Contains Natural Digestive Enzymes

Papaya contains papain, an enzyme that helps break down proteins in the stomach. This prevents food from getting “stuck” and causing bloating.

A Gentle and Hydrating Fruit

Papaya is soft, easy to digest, and rich in water. This makes it perfect for people who want a light food that supports digestion.

You can eat papaya:

  • In the morning

  • After lunch

  • As an evening snack

6. Bananas

Bananas are one of the best foods for reducing bloating caused by extra water in the body.

Rich in Potassium

Potassium helps balance the water levels in the body and reduces water retention. This directly helps with stomach bloating.

Soft and Easy on the Stomach

Bananas break down easily and help settle the stomach, making them ideal for people who have sensitive digestion.

7. Cucumber

Cucumber is a cooling food that helps reduce both gas and bloating.

High Water Content

Cucumbers help cool the stomach, reduce irritation, and prevent inflammation.

Helps Release Excess Water and Salt

Because cucumbers are hydrating, they help flush out extra water and sodium from the body, reducing stomach swelling.

Add cucumbers to:

  • Salads

  • Sandwiches

  • Hydrating drinks

They are especially refreshing during Dubai’s hot weather.

Best Daily Habits to Reduce Gas and Bloating

Eating the right foods is helpful, but daily habits matter just as much. Try to:

  • Chew food slowly

  • Drink warm water regularly

  • Avoid carbonated drinks

  • Eat smaller meals

  • Walk for 5–10 minutes after eating

  • Reduce very spicy or oily foods

These habits help the digestive system work more smoothly.

Who Should Be Careful With Certain Foods

  • People with IBS (Irritable Bowel Syndrome) may react differently

  • People who are lactose intolerant should avoid regular yogurt

  • Anyone with a history of stomach problems should speak to a doctor first
